Example 1: format date js

var options = { weekday: 'long', year: 'numeric', month: 'long', day: 'numeric' };
var today  = new Date();

console.log(today.toLocaleDateString("en-US")); // 9/17/2016
console.log(today.toLocaleDateString("en-US", options)); // Saturday, September 17, 2016

 // For custom format use
 date.toLocaleDateString("en-US", { day: 'numeric' })+ "-"+ date.toLocaleDateString("en-US", { month: 'short' })+ "-" + date.toLocaleDateString("en-US", { year: 'numeric' }) // 16-Nov-2019

Example 2: javascript format date time

function formatDate(date) {
    var hours = date.getHours();
    var minutes = date.getMinutes();
    var ampm = hours >= 12 ? "PM" : "AM";
    hours = hours % 12;
    hours = hours ? hours : 12; // the hour "0" should be "12"
    minutes = minutes < 10 ? "0" + minutes : minutes;
    var strTime = hours + ":" + minutes + " " + ampm;
    return date.getDate() + "/" + new Intl.DateTimeFormat('en', { month: 'short' }).format(date) + "/" + date.getFullYear() + " " + strTime;
}

var d = new Date();
var e = formatDate(d);

console.log(e); // example output: 11/Feb/2021 1:23 PM

Example 5: Javascript format date / time

var date = new Date('2014-8-20');
console.log((date.getMonth()+1) + '/' + date.getDate() + '/' +  date.getFullYear());

Example 6: get date format javascript

//Date format
  const handleDate = (dataD) => {
    let data= new Date(dataD)
    let month = data.getMonth() + 1
    let day = data.getDate()
    let year = data.getFullYear()
    if(day<=9)
      day = '0' + day
    if(month<10)
      month = '0' + month
    const postDate = year + '-' + month + '-' + day
    return postDate
  }
